ISIC 1610—Sawmilling and planing of wood
Class · International Standard Industrial Classification (Revision 5 (2024))
Where 1610 sits
What 1610 includes
- Sawmilling, planning, processing and finishing of wood
- Sawing, planing and machining of wood
- Slicing, peeling or chipping logs
- Manufacture of wooden railway sleepers
- Manufacture of unassembled wooden flooring
- Manufacture outside of forest of wood wool, wood sawdust and flour, wood chips and particles
- Impregnation or chemical treatment of wood with preservatives or other materials
- General activities for the processing and finishing of wood, which are typically carried out on a fee or contract basis
- Boring, turning, milling, eroding, planning, lapping, broaching, levelling, sawing, grinding, sharpening, polishing, welding, splicing etc. of wood
- Industrial drying of wood
- Impregnation or chemical treatment of wood
- Treatment of wood in the rough with paint, stains or other preservatives
